Fish Health Inspector: (40% of the fish health workforce) Fish health inspectors monitor and enforce regulations related to fish farming and wild fish populations. They ensure the health and welfare of fish, preventing diseases and reducing environmental impacts. 2. Aquaculture Veterinarian: (30% of the fish health workforce) Aquaculture veterinarians diagnose and treat diseases in farmed fish, improving fish health and contributing to sustainable aquaculture practices. They collaborate with farmers, researchers, and policymakers to optimise fish health management strategies. 3. Fish Nutritionist: (15% of the fish health workforce) Fish nutritionists study fish feeding habits and develop optimal diets for various fish species. They contribute to sustainable aquaculture by improving feed conversion ratios and reducing waste, contributing to healthier fish populations. 4. Fish Pathologist: (10% of the fish health workforce) Fish pathologists investigate and diagnose diseases affecting fish populations. Their work aids in understanding disease transmission, developing prevention strategies, and improving fish health management. 5. Fish Geneticist: (5% of the fish health workforce) Fish geneticists research fish genetics, contributing to the development of selective breeding programs and understanding the genetic basis of disease resistance. They help create hardier fish strains, reducing the need for medical interventions and increasing the overall sustainability of fish farming practices.
